Pokemon TCG Printed 10.2 Billion Cards in 2024, Less Than the Previous Year
The Pokemon Company has released its latest figures report, revealing 10.2 billion Pokemon cards were produced from March 2024 to March 2025.
That's 1.7 billion fewer cards than in 2023, when 11.9 billion were printed -- a decrease of about 14%. However, the 2024 figure is still higher than in 2022, when 9.7 billion cards were produced.
Before 2019, Pokemon was producing an average of 1.5 to 2 billion cards a year.
According to The Pokemon Company, over 75 billion Pokemon cards have been produced worldwide as of March 2025. Here are the reports I've received from Pokemon since starting PokeBeach in 2003:
March 2025: Over 75 billion cards worldwide in 16 languages and 90 countries and regions
- March 2024: Over 64.8 billion cards worldwide in 15 languages and 93 countries and regions
- March 2023: Over 52.9 billion cards worldwide in 14 languages and 89 countries and regions
- March 2022: Over 43.2 billion cards worldwide in 13 languages and 77 areas
- March 2021: Over 34.1 billion cards worldwide in 13 languages and 77 areas
- March 2020: Over 30.4 billion cards worldwide in 13 languages and 77 areas
- September 2019: Over 28.8 billion cards worldwide in 13 languages and 77 areas
- March 2019: Over 27.2 billion cards worldwide in 12 languages and 77 countries and regions
- March 2018: Over 25.7 billion cards worldwide in 11 languages and 74 countries and regions
- March 2017: Over 23.6 billion cards worldwide in 11 languages and 74 countries and regions
- Between 2014 and 2016: Over 21.5 billion cards worldwide in 10 languages and 74 countries and regions
- Between 2004 and 2010: Over 14 billion cards worldwide in 30-40 countries
As I've reported before, it doesn't seem Pokemon kept accurate records for the total number of cards printed before 2017. However, it's likely the reported change in totals from year to year is now accurate.
